Today fuboTV announced that they add 6 new locals. This will give fuboTV a total of 294 live locals. These include stations owned & operated by or affiliated with CBS, FOX, NBC, The CW or Telemundo; plus access to FOX network programming in 36 additional local markets:
- FOX coverage in 91% of U.S. households, including 50 of the top 50 and 136 markets total.
- NBC coverage in 74% of U.S. households, including 42 of the top 50. (80 markets total)
- CBS coverage in 70% of U.S. households, including 20 of the top 20 markets and 35 of the top 50. (73 markets total)
- TEL coverage in 67% of U.S. Hispanic households (on 26 local stations).
Here is everything being added to day:
FOX (all three replace FOXNets in the market)
- KMSB – Tuscon, AZ (Sierra Vista)
- WBRC – Birmingham, AL (Anniston-Tuscaloosa)
- WTNZ – Knoxville, TN
TEL
- WRMD – Tampa, FL
- WTMO – Orlando-Daytona Beach-Melbourne, FL
- KUAN – San Diego, CA
